Verify that the baseline.sarif file in the Quillgate repository has not been edited to suppress new findings. The baseline may only grow smaller over time; any addition of suppressed rules requires a documented waiver in the audit log. As a contractor, do not regenerate the baseline yourself — the regeneration script requires sign-off and a recorded justification. Confirm the last modification date matches the waiver register. Discrepancies must be reported directly to the baseline owner named below.

account owner for bawip-tahag: Raleth Quenok

Handover note — Widediff service (from Petra to Lukas)

For the release manager's awareness: Widediff, our diff viewer for large files, is mid-upgrade to the chunked-rendering backend. The Ostermark build passed load tests up to 4 GB inputs; the streaming tokenizer still stutters on binary-adjacent files, tracked separately. Release gate is green otherwise. Canary sits at 10% and can go to 50% Monday. Nothing else is blocking. The settings currently live on the canary pool are listed below.

config for kafof-bawef:
holath:
  log_level: debug
  metrics_host: metrics.holath.qorvelsys.internal
  pin: 2191
  pool_size: 32

This release accompanies the quarterly rotation of the signing key used for the Lattice template-rendering service at Ferncastle Systems. No functional changes to the renderer itself; the 18% latency improvement from partial-compilation caching shipped in 2.9.0 and remains unchanged. All artifacts from this tag forward are signed with the rotated key, and the previous key is revoked effective immediately. Verify any cached 2.9.0 artifacts before promotion, as mixed-key bundles will fail gate checks. The new signing key is provided below.

release key, fahaf-bajof: bky3_Xam

Subject: Review requested — Keywell password reset flow revamp

Hi,

The reset flow revamp is ready for your pass. Key changes: tokens are now single-use with a fifteen-minute expiry, the email dispatch moved behind the Brindle queue to avoid timing leaks, and failed attempts are rate-limited per account rather than per address. Please pay particular attention to the constant-time comparison in the verifier and the new enumeration-safe error copy. Staging is deployed; the build you should review is identified by the token below.

session token of kageg-tahop = htk14_af3c1ccccb7dcf